Victoria Vilkas, respondent, v. Gil Howard Vilkas, appellant.


Unpublished Opinion

MOTION DECISION

COLLEEN D. DUFFY, J.P., PAUL WOOTEN, LARA J. GENOVESI, HELEN VOUTSINAS, JJ.

D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Appeal by Gil Howard Vilkas from an order of the Supreme Court, Queens County, dated January 13, 2023. By order to show cause dated May 22, 2023, the parties were directed to show cause before this Court why an order should or should not be made and entered dismissing the appeal in the above-entitled proceedings for failure to comply with a scheduling order dated March 24, 2023, issued pursuant to § 670.3(b)(2) of the rules of this Court (22 NYCRR 670.3[b][2]).

Now, upon the order to show cause and no papers having been filed in response th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ion to dismiss the appeal is granted, and the appeal is dismissed, without costs or disbursements, for failure to comply with the scheduling order dated March 24, 2023, issued pursuant to § 670.3(b)(2) of the rules of this Court (22 NYCRR 670.3[b][2]).

DUFFY, J.P., WOOTEN, GENOVESI and VOUTSINAS, JJ., concur.
